Class: Struct
Direct Known Subclasses
Cache::Strategy::LFU::Item, Cache::Strategy::LRU::Item, Cache::Strategy::Unbounded::Item, Wee::Brush::SelectListTag::SelectListCallback, Wee::Component::OnAnswer, Wee::Context, Wee::Page, Wee::RenderingContext
Instance Method Summary collapse
Instance Method Details
#restore_snapshot(snap) ⇒ Object
44 45 46 |
# File 'lib/wee/snapshot_ext.rb', line 44 def restore_snapshot(snap) snap.each_pair {|k,v| send(k.to_s + "=", v)} end |
#take_snapshot ⇒ Object
38 39 40 41 42 |
# File 'lib/wee/snapshot_ext.rb', line 38 def take_snapshot snap = Hash.new each_pair {|k,v| snap[k] = v} snap end |